The temperature obviously varies considerably from the poles to the equator but the average temperature of the ocean surface waters is about 17 degrees Celsius (62.6 degrees Fahrenheit).

The average temperature in a tropical rainforest typically ranges from 20°C to 25°C (68°F to 77°F). The average precipitation in a tropical rainforest is around 2,000 to 10,000 millimeters (80 to 400 inches) per year, with consistent rainfall throughout the year.
